Comandante Luis Piedra Buena Pier: A Gateway to Patagonian Shores

A historic pier in Puerto Madryn offering stunning views, marine wildlife spotting, and a taste of Patagonian culture.

4.6

The Comandante Luis Piedra Buena Pier in Puerto Madryn is a historic pier offering stunning ocean views and a glimpse into the region's maritime past. Built in 1909, it serves as a popular spot for tourists, providing access to marine wildlife watching and local culture.

Getting There

  • Walking

    If you're already in central Puerto Madryn, walking to the Comandante Luis Piedra Buena Pier is straightforward. From Plaza Puerto Madryn, head southwest on Av. Roca, then turn left onto Av. Guillermo Rawson. The pier is a few blocks away, about a 15-minute walk. There are no costs associated with walking.

  • Public Transport

    To reach the pier via public transport, take a local bus that routes towards the coast. Look for buses displaying 'Puerto Madryn Centro' or 'Costanera' on their front. Inform the driver you want to get off at Av. Guillermo Rawson; the pier is a short walk (approximately 200 meters) from the bus stop. Bus fares are typically low, requiring local currency. Check local bus schedules as they may vary.

  • Taxi/Ride-Share

    Taxis and ride-sharing services are readily available in Puerto Madryn. A short taxi ride from the city center to the pier should cost approximately $3.5 USD. Confirm the fare with the driver before starting your trip. Ride-sharing apps like Cabify or Uber may also be available.

  • Car

    If driving, head southwest on Av. Guillermo Rawson from the center of Puerto Madryn. Follow the avenue for about 1 kilometer until you reach the Comandante Luis Piedra Buena Pier, located at 100 Av. Guillermo Rawson. Parking may be available nearby. Parking costs vary, but expect to pay around ARS 50-100 per hour.

Discover more about Comandante Luis Piedra Buena Pier

The Comandante Luis Piedra Buena Pier, located in Puerto Madryn, Argentina, is more than just a pier; it's a historical landmark and a vibrant hub of activity. Stretching into the Golfo Nuevo, the pier provides stunning views of the ocean, the city, and the surrounding Patagonian landscape. Originally built in 1909 and opened in 1910, the pier was named after Luis Piedra Buena, an Argentine sailor who played a crucial role in asserting national sovereignty in southern Argentina. The pier initially facilitated the import and export of goods, connecting Puerto Madryn to other Patagonian ports, Buenos Aires, and international destinations. Over time, with the rise of highway transport, the pier transitioned towards tourism. Today, the pier is a popular destination for both locals and tourists. Visitors can stroll along the pier, enjoying the sea breeze and panoramic views. It's also a prime location for spotting marine wildlife, including seals and, during the whale-watching season (June to December), southern right whales. The pier also serves as a docking point for cruise ships, bringing international visitors to Puerto Madryn. Local artisans often display their crafts on the pier, offering unique souvenirs. The pier's structure has evolved over the years, with expansions to accommodate larger vessels. While parts of the original wooden and iron structure remain, modern additions have made it a functional and attractive public space.
